Where I’ve been eating
The Melting Pot at Oak Valley in Grabouw / Elgin
I finally made it to the now-permanent home of chef John van Zyl and his partner Sage Fell. I have followed their food journey from a pop-up to their first venue on Wale Street and it’s every bit as delicious. Their menu includes globally inspired small plates as well as a few bistro classics such as steak and chips and chicken liver parfait. You could also nibble on a charcuterie platter while sipping wine under the oaks or next to the pool. They also sell picnic baskets which you could enjoy in the beautiful garden. Their chicken burger was probably the best I’ve ever eaten. Packed with flavour in a homemade brioche bun. I cannot wait to go back.
Karen Dudley X The Vista Lounge at the One & Only
Karen Dudley has teamed up with the One & Only resort Executive Chef, Jacques Swart to bring you a few of her delicious dishes on the new Vista Bar & Lounge menu. I went to taste them all and was blown away. I cannot stop thinking about them. This menu is plant-forward and packed with flavour and texture.
The Nines
This new trendy Roof-top terrace lounge and restaurant has just opened in Sea Point. The views from 3 sides are spectacular. I went to the opening party (spot me below in this pic taken by The Inside Guide), and went back for a light lunch on Saturday. The food was delicious and the menu was fairly big covering seafood, meat, pasta, risotto, vegetarian dishes, and desserts. This new Kove Collection property is set to become the newest hot spot on the Atlantic seaboard. There is ample (expensive) parking in the building and a lift takes you up to the ninth floor.
